Saying Garand is a nobody is proof you didn't do your HW. Young goalie playing well in the AHL, <2 years from winning the best goalie in the CHL and backstopping canada to the U20 wjc gold medal. Arguably a top 10 goalie prospect rn.

Kakko's floor is similar to Wrights, but Wright does has a higher ceiling (for now, saying this because since kakko is ~3 years older he's more known in terms of what he will be as an NHLer). Hard to compare the two since Kakko never spent time in the AHL (was definitely needed). Wright has only played 11 nhl games (he has 2 points in d+1&d+2 to date) so it's a little to small of a sample, even when just comparing to Kakko's rookie year (d+1, 23 points in 66 games). For the higher ceiling, they get Garand + 2nd. And I wouldn't knock a 2nd round pick, Cuylle (60), Poitras (54), Knies (57), Moser (60), Faber (45) were all mid-late second rounders since 2020.
